SBTS vs. Catawba College Cost Comparison
Which college is more expensive, SBTS or Catawba College? Published tuition is the sticker price; many students pay less after aid (see average net price below).
- The typical actual cost that students pay to attend (average net price) is less at Catawba College than SBTS ($18,447 vs. $21,081).
-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at The Southern Baptist Theological Seminary are 37.6% lower than at Catawba College ($8,466 vs. $13,565).
- Catawba College is 210.5% more expensive for in-state tuition than SBTS (about $23,254 more per year; $34,300.00 vs. $11,046.00).
- Out-of-state tuition is 210.5% higher at Catawba College than at The Southern Baptist Theological Seminary (about $23,254 more per year; $34,300.00 vs. $11,046.00).
- A larger share of students receive grant aid at Catawba College than at The Southern Baptist Theological Seminary (100% vs. 33%).
- The average total grant financial aid received by Catawba College students is 1,810% larger than aid received by The Southern Baptist Theological Seminary students ($30,808 vs. $1,613).
SBTS vs. Catawba College Admissions comparison
Which college is harder to get into, SBTS or Catawba College? Typical SAT and ACT scores (same estimates as in the table above), middle 50% test ranges where reported, test score submission policy, deadlines, and acceptance rates summarize admission difficulty between Catawba College and SBTS.
- The typical SAT score (median estimate) at Catawba College (1170) is 50 points higher than at SBTS (1120).
- Incoming SBTS students have a 2 point higher typical ACT composite (median estimate) (23 vs. 21 at Catawba College).
- Reported middle 50% SAT composite range (25th-75th percentile) for admitted students: The Southern Baptist Theological Seminary 1010/1230; Catawba College 1030/1300.
- Reported middle 50% ACT composite range (25th-75th percentile) for admitted students: The Southern Baptist Theological Seminary 19/27; Catawba College 17/25.
- Submitting SAT or ACT scores: SBTS - Required; Catawba College - Test optional.
- Typical fall application deadline: SBTS Jul 15, 2027; Catawba College Aug 15, 2027.
- Catawba College has a higher acceptance rate (75.2%) than SBTS (55.9%).
- The share of admitted students who enrolled (yield) is 55.9% at SBTS vs. 12.5% at Catawba College.
